Description
A monstrous dark creature with flame-orange eyes and gaping red mouth dominates this medieval composition, its cavernous interior populated by writhing pale figures in states of torment and despair. The artist renders the beast in deep charcoal and black with intricate detailing, contrasting sharply against the vivid crimson interior and golden highlights that bring a nightmarish intensity to this vision of damnation.
